Analysis

Bhutan recorded 38,110 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re for goods imports (bop, current us$), per square kilometre in 2023. That is the highest value across all 18 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 6.0% on the previous year and up 57.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, goods imports (bop, current us$), per square kilometre in Bhutan peaked at 38,110 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re in 2023 and was at its lowest, 11,409 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re, in 2006.

Bhutan ranks 147th of 198 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 18 years of available data.

Goods imports (BoP, current US$), per square kilometre in Bhutan, year by year

Annual values for Goods imports (BoP, current US$), per square kilometre in Bhutan, 2006 to 2023.
Year BoP, current US$ per square kilometre Change
2006 11,409 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re
2007 13,036 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re +14.3%
2008 16,920 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re +29.8%
2009 15,307 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re -9.5%
2010 20,857 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re +36.3%
2011 29,593 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re +41.9%
2012 26,561 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re -10.2%
2013 24,228 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re -8.8%
2014 24,368 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re +0.6%
2015 26,460 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re +8.6%
2016 27,001 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re +2.0%
2017 26,874 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re -0.5%
2018 26,749 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re -0.5%
2019 26,495 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re -1.0%
2020 25,248 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re -4.7%
2021 23,344 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re -7.5%
2022 35,962 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re +54.1%
2023 38,110 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re +6.0%

Bhutan compared with similar countries

  • Bhutan's 38,110 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re is below the median for lower middle income countries, which is 52,424 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re, 73% of the median. (47 countries reporting)
  • Bhutan's 38,110 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re is below the median for South Asia, which is 250,423 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re, 15% of the median. (6 countries reporting)

How this figure is calculated

Goods imports (BoP, current US$)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Goods imports (BoP, current US$)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
